settle for
US /ˈset.l̩ fɔːr/
UK /ˈset.l̩ fɔːr/

片語動詞
1.
滿足於
To accept something that is not exactly what you want but is the best that is available.
範例:
•
She didn’t want to settle for a lower salary, but she needed the job.
